Wood Window Service in Boone, NC
Wood window service includes a range of projects focused on the repair, restoration, and maintenance of wooden window frames, sashes, and components. Homeowners often seek these services to address issues such as rotting wood, damaged or broken window parts, drafts, or difficulty opening and closing windows. The work may involve replacing deteriorated wood, refurbishing existing frames, or upgrading windows to improve energy efficiency and curb appeal. Property owners typically want to understand the scope of work needed, the materials used, and how the service can help prolong the lifespan of their wood windows while maintaining their aesthetic appeal.
Before requesting wood window services, property owners should consider the current condition of their windows, including any signs of rot, warping, or damage. It’s helpful to determine whether repairs or replacements are more appropriate for the situation, and to inquire about the types of finishes or treatments available to protect the wood from future deterioration. Understanding the extent of work involved and the expected outcomes can assist homeowners in making informed decisions about maintaining or restoring their wooden windows effectively.

Common Wood Window Service Jobs
Wood window restoration - involves repairing and refinishing existing wood frames to extend their lifespan.
Wood window replacement - provides new, energy-efficient wood windows to improve home comfort and appearance.
Custom wood window fabrication - offers tailored solutions to match unique architectural styles and preferences.
Wood window sash repair - restores damaged or rotted sashes for proper operation and aesthetics.
Wood window reglazing - replaces old or cracked glass to enhance safety and insulation.
Wood window maintenance - includes cleaning, sealing, and protecting wood surfaces to prevent deterioration.
Wood Window Service Questions
What types of wood window services are available? Services include repairs, restoration, reglazing, and custom replacements for residential and commercial properties in Boone, NC.
How can wood window repairs improve energy efficiency? Repairs help seal gaps, replace damaged wood, and restore insulation, reducing drafts and improving indoor comfort.
What signs indicate a wood window needs service? Common signs include rotting wood, cracked or broken glass, difficulty opening or closing, and visible warping or swelling.
Are wood window restorations suitable for historic homes? Yes, restorations preserve the original character while improving function and durability of historic wood windows.
